Types of support available
In Bennett, there are several types of support available for individuals experiencing domestic violence:
- Lawyers: Legal professionals who can assist with restraining orders and other legal matters.
- Therapists: Mental health professionals who provide counseling and emotional support.
- Shelters: Safe spaces offering temporary housing and support services for individuals in crisis.
- Hotlines: 24/7 support lines where you can talk to someone trained to help.
- Legal Aid: Organizations that offer free or low-cost legal assistance.
Legal protections overview
In Colorado, individuals affected by domestic violence can seek various legal protections, including restraining orders and emergency protection orders. These legal measures are designed to keep you safe and can be pursued through local courts. It's important to understand your rights and the resources available to help you navigate the legal system.
Safety planning basics
Creating a safety plan is a crucial step in ensuring your well-being. A safety plan may include identifying a safe place to go, having a packed bag ready, and establishing a code word with trusted friends or family. Always prioritize your safety and take steps to protect yourself in potentially dangerous situations.
